Similarly low risk of hepatocellular carcinoma after either spontaneous or nucleos(t)ide analogue-induced hepatitis B surface antigen loss.

Terry Cheuk Fung YipVincent Wai-Sun WongYee-Kit TseLilian Yan LiangVicki Wing-Ki HuiXinrong ZhangGuan-Lin LiGrace Chung-Yan LuiHenry Lik Yuen ChanGrace Lai-Hung Wong
Published in: Alimentary pharmacology & therapeutics (2020)
The HCC risk was similarly low after either spontaneous or NA-induced HBsAg seroclearance in a territory-wide cohort of patients with CHB who had cleared HBsAg.
